The total area of the survey is ~1.5 square degrees with the limiting sensitivity of ~10^{-14} erg/s/cm^2, corresponding to the luminosity of ~4.3\\cdot 10^{33} erg/s at the SMC distance. Out of ~150 point sources detected in the 2--8 keV energy band, ~3/4 are background CXB sources, observed through the SMC.
